适合软件工程师的电影集锦:从《矩阵》到《银翼杀手》

需积分: 5 0 下载量 102 浏览量 更新于2024-11-20 收藏 7KB ZIP 举报
资源摘要信息: "谷歌师兄的leetcode刷题笔记-dev-movies: 适合软件开发人员、IT工程师以及对电影感兴趣的观众的电影推荐列表,附有对每部电影的简要概述。" 知识点详细说明: 1. 软件开发与IT行业: - 软件开发: 软件开发是指设计、实现、测试和维护软件的过程,涉及编程、算法设计、系统分析等多个方面。 - IT工程师: IT工程师通常负责计算机系统的规划、构建和维护,包括软件、硬件和网络。 - LeetCode: LeetCode是一个在线编程平台,提供算法题库供用户练习,是很多软件开发工程师面试准备的常用资源。 2. 推荐电影列表及分析: - 电影《阴谋》(Inception, 2010): 由克里斯托弗·诺兰执导的科幻片,讲述了通过进入梦境共享技术窃取信息的故事。该电影在视觉特效、剧本和概念上受到赞誉,适合喜欢技术与奇幻结合的观众。 - 电影《矩阵》(The Matrix, 1999): 影片描绘了一个反乌托邦未来,人类生活在一个由有自我意识的机器创造的虚拟现实中。这部电影对科幻迷和程序员尤其有吸引力,提出了对现实认知和自由意志的深刻探讨。 - 电影《终结者》(The Terminator, 1991): 讲述了人工智能发展到能自我复制和进行战争的阶段,最终与人类形成对立的故事。电影中对机器人与人类战斗的描写,对技术的潜在威胁进行了设想。 - 电影《异形》(Alien, 2009): 是一部科幻惊悚片,讨论了工程学的风险和责任。影片中展示了科学发明如病毒逆变器,给观众带来了对科技后果的思考。 - 电影《2001太空漫游》(2001: A Space Odyssey, 1968): 一部经典的科幻电影,探讨了人工智能的出现,以及人类与智能机器之间的关系。 - 电影《银翼杀手》(Blade Runner, 2017): 探索了人类创造的复制人(androids)与人类关系的故事,对身份、意识和存在的哲学问题提出了讨论。 - 电影《分裂》(Split, 2016): 讲述了一对夫妻接受了医疗程序以分离彼此记忆的故事,可以引出关于记忆、人格和社会心理学的话题。 3. 系统开源标签含义: - 开源: 指的是软件的源代码可以被公开查看、修改和分发的一种模式。开源软件鼓励共享、协作和创新,与传统的闭源软件相对。 - 系统: 在这里可能指操作系统或计算机系统,开源系统如Linux、Android等被广泛应用于计算机、移动设备等领域。 4. 文件名称列表: - dev-movies-master: 这个名称可能指向了一个压缩文件夹,里面包含了与电影推荐相关的一系列文件,例如电影介绍、评论或者与软件开发相关的参考材料。"master"一词暗示了这是一个主版本或核心版本,可能包含了一系列的资源和资料。 通过以上分析,我们可以看出,这些电影不仅为普通观众提供了娱乐,也包含了丰富的技术元素和深层次的哲学思考,是软件开发人员和IT工程师可以从中汲取灵感和反思的资源。同时,推荐列表还附带了开源系统的标签,可能意味着推荐的电影与开源社区有关联,或者推荐者希望观众能够像对待开源项目那样去挖掘电影背后更深层次的意义。